Transponder Keys

Basically, transponder keys have a microchip inside them which transmits a unique code to the vehicle. The code is matched to a specific serial number on the computer system in the car. If the code does not match, the car will not start. This technology has helped decrease car thefts.

The majority of cars manufactured in the last 20 years are outfitted with this amazing technology. If you own an older car, it is possible to create transponder keys. Beishir Lock and Security can cut a new key and program the chip for you at less than the cost of a dealership.

This technology was created to stop car theft. Prior to this, thieves could touch two wires together on the ignition switch of the car and turn it on. The transponder technology can stop this from happening because the vehicle will not start when the correct code isn't sent to the immobilizer system.

The chip can also be used to unlock doors and trunks without pressing an button. These "smart" Audi fobs have proximity sensors that will activate when the owner is within a few feet of the vehicle. The sensor will transmit a signal to the vehicle to allow trunks and doors to unlock and open.

One drawback of the transponder system is that it can be difficult to detect issues. A damaged battery is typically the reason behind keys that don't turn in the ignition. Side Cut Keys

If you require a standard key cut to open your doors and start the engine, we can make one for you at less cost than an auto dealer. We also provide laser-cut keys that have an internal groove running the length of the product. This allows the key to be put in from either side. The metal cuts on a laser-cut key are more robust, thicker and more durable than those on the standard cut key.

Audi has used transponder keys since early 1990s. However, security systems have become more secure as time passes. These transponders are more sophisticated and have a higher security level than keys found in other vehicles, making them more difficult to take. In addition to the standard side-cut blade, Audi transponder keys have a unique PIN that is required to program them. While a professional locksmith is able to cut keys with the same quality and precision as the dealer, they aren't able to program it to your vehicle without this code.
